首页 > 信息 > 你问我答 >

RGB颜色怎样用十六进制表示

更新时间:发布时间: 作者:盲流子1962

RGB颜色怎样用十六进制表示】在日常设计、网页开发和图像处理中,RGB(红绿蓝)颜色模型是一种非常常见的颜色表示方式。而为了更方便地在代码或设计软件中使用这些颜色,通常会将RGB值转换为十六进制(Hex)格式。下面我们将对如何将RGB颜色转换为十六进制进行总结,并提供一个清晰的表格供参考。

一、RGB与十六进制的关系

RGB颜色由三个分量组成:红色(Red)、绿色(Green)、蓝色(Blue),每个分量的取值范围是0到255。而十六进制颜色则由6个字符组成,前两位代表红色,中间两位代表绿色,最后两位代表蓝色,每个部分都是两位的十六进制数(00到FF)。

例如,RGB(255, 0, 0) 表示纯红色,对应的十六进制是 `FF0000`。

二、转换方法

1. 将RGB的每个分量转换为十六进制

每个分量(R、G、B)从十进制转换为两位的十六进制数,不足两位时前面补零。

2. 组合成六位十六进制字符串

将三个分量的十六进制结果按顺序拼接,并在前面加上“”符号。

三、常见颜色对照表

RGB 值 十六进制表示 颜色名称
(0, 0, 0) 000000 黑色
(255, 255, 255) FFFFFF 白色
(255, 0, 0) FF0000 红色
(0, 255, 0) 00FF00 绿色
(0, 0, 255) 0000FF 蓝色
(255, 255, 0) FFFF00 黄色
(0, 255, 255) 00FFFF 青色
(255, 0, 255) FF00FF 品红
(128, 128, 128) 808080 灰色
(255, 165, 0) FFA500 橙色

四、注意事项

- 如果某个分量的数值小于16(即0~15),在转换为十六进制时需要补零,如RGB(5, 10, 15) → 050A0F。

- 十六进制颜色可以简写为3位形式,如ABC 表示 AABBCC,但这种写法并不适用于所有场合。

- 在网页设计中,使用十六进制颜色能更好地兼容各种浏览器和设备。

通过以上方法,你可以轻松地将RGB颜色转换为十六进制表示,便于在前端开发、UI设计等场景中使用。希望这篇总结对你有所帮助!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。